CONDITIONS FOR OBTAINING VISAS FOR NIGER As of September 25, 2007, the conditions for obtaining an entry visa in Niger are: - A passport valid for at least six months
- Three (3) visa forms to fill and signers (addresses in Canada and Niger, although accurate)
- Three (3) passport photos updated passport-size high quality and taken by a professional photographer (though include the full name on back)
- One (1) letter explaining the purpose of your visit to Niger
- A photocopy of your itinerary or airline ticket
- A prepaid envelope for return of your passport
- A money order (postal or bank money order or certified check) to:
CAN $ 83.00 for a stay exceeding 30 days CAN $ 123.00 for a stay of one to three months CAN $ 160.00 multiple entry visa for a stay of three months maximum - Payment by debit card, Visa or cash is not accepted
- A vaccination certificate valid
- The period of validity of the visa run from the date of entry in Niger
- Proof of custody (father, mother, guardian) must accompany the passport of a minor
- A minimum of 5 working days required for processing the application
- The visa section is open Monday through Friday from 9 hours to 12 hours
- Note: The term of visa validity runs from the date of entry to Niger.

REQUEST FOR EXTENSION OF PASSPORT An application form for passport extension to complete and sign The old passport Three (3) passport photos The cost of stamps of $ 123.00 CAN An application to the Embassy
PASSPORT APPLICATION Renewing passport is in Niamey at the relevant departments and the passport application dossier includes regular - One (1) printed application form and signed by the applicant
- One (1) certified copy of identity card or valid passport of the former
- Four (4) passport photos
- The cost of stamps valued at 50 000 FCFA
- A certified copy of birth certificate for minor children under 15 years.
TUITION EXEMPTION FOREIGN NGO AGREEMENT APPLICATION Documents to be Furnished by the NGO for the Purpose of Receiving a Provisional Recipicé
- In accordance with Article 7 of l’Ordonnance No 8406 of the 1st March 1984, covering rules for associations, the Foreign NGO Agreement Application should be
- deposited with Niger’s Diplomatic Mission.
The file must include the following documents: - By-Laws
- Internal regulations
- The NGO’s plan of action in Niger
- List of founding members
- The legal status of the NGO in Canada
- List of current officers and officials
- The last Annual Report of the organization
- An official letter of accreditation for the NGO’s representative in Niger along with the person’s Curriculum Vitae
